The problem
Email is where key coordination happens, but it's also where threads get missed, replies get delayed, and follow-ups slip.
Switching between Gmail and Slack adds friction and slows teams down.
The solution
Email, prioritized and actionable; inside Slack.
Tredly highlights what matters, summarizes it, and suggests next steps, so your team can move forward from Slack with one click.
What you can do with Tredly
See what matters
Highlights priority emails and action items
Reply in one click
Smart drafts, quick replies, archive, and snooze - all right in Slack.
Stay proactive
Get notified when a conversation needs a reply, you owe a response, or an action item is overdue.
Manage meetings
Create Google Meet invites, and accept/decline meeting requests without leaving Slack
